javascript中的$(“something”)是什么意思

What does $("something") in javascript mean?

本文关键字:是什么 意思 something 中的 javascript      更新时间:2023-09-26

可能重复:
"$”登录javascript

这可能是一个基本问题,但我敢问。

在浏览javascript代码时,我发现了以下内容。

    if(selected_len == all_len) {
        $(":checkbox:checked.node_id_"+d.nodeValue).click();
    }

我试着搜索$(")的意思,但我只找到了

"$('hello')--这是一个被许多JavaScript框架声明为document.getElementById扩展的函数。"

你能给出更准确的解释吗,就像你和孩子说话一样:)

$是一个变量名。它意味着分配给该变量的函数被定义为什么。(这不是一个好的变量名称。

它的内容看起来像一个CSS选择器,所以它很可能是对jQuery对象的常见、快速键入的引用。

理论上,它的意思无非是foo():它是一个函数调用,其中$是函数的名称($是Javascript中标识符的合法名称)。

在通常的实践中,$是众所周知的jQuery库的"入口点"。还有其他库使用名称$作为入口点,但jQuery可以说是使用最广泛的库。

正如其他人所说,它只是一个函数名,如果您使用其他使用$sign的库,则可以使用jQuery关键字而不是$sign。